• Conference Exhibits:  Providing information and resources about expressive arts and healing as they relate to mental illness
  • Expressive Arts Classes:  Teaching others to use art to express emotion in a healthy process of self-discovery, healing and growth
  • "Unraveling My Purple Sweater" Exhibit:  Display of the 77 color pencil drawings from the book "Unraveling My Purple Sweater:  The Beginning of My Journey Through Depression" by Amy Kinney.  Full exhibit requires about 300 square feet.  Includes free-standing displays for all of the artwork.  Layout can be designed to accomodate even unusual spaces.

  • Educational Workshops and Presentations:  Faciliating open dialogue in both large and small groups to break the silence surrounding mental illness and share Amy's story and healing journey.
  • Artist Coaching:  Guiding artists through the process of presenting their artwork.  Topics include locating venues, business development, marketing techniques, accounting, and website design.
  •  Shows and Gallery Exhibits: Displays of recent works by Amy Kinney. 

This project is funded by exhibit and workshop fees, as well as Amy's personal artwork sales.  Finances should never restrict a group or organization from sharing this important message of hope and education within the community.  Fees are purposely kept as low as possible with a sliding scale when necessary.  The goal is to spread the healing power of art and to connect with as many people as possible.  Whatever your circumstances are, we can make it happen.
